Catholic society condemns attraction to wealth

Takoradi, July 18, GNA – The Knights of St John International, a friendly society within the Catholic Church, on Monday expressed worry over the increasing attraction to wealth and materialism in society.

A communiqué copied to the Ghana News Agency at the end of the eighth Biennial Convention of the Cape Coast Grand Commandery and Ladies Auxiliary of the society, said the open-mindedness of society was gradually eroding the understanding of “what is social evil and sin.”

It said the introduction of untraditional elements into society and the exposure of the youth to unacceptable behaviour had become the bane of civil society.

The communiqué signed by Brigadier-General Naaba Sigri Bewong, Grand President of the Commandery, rejected suggestion that that homosexuality and lesbianism should be legalized.

“We recommit ourselves to the venerable teachings of the Catholic Church on the sanctity of human life and the sacredness of the institution of marriage as well as family values,” it said.

The communiqué also condemned acts of some social commentators and political party fanatics who indulge in insults and said “As a fraternal society we encourage and develop the spirit of love of country and its institutions”.
